Support and General Use > Audio Playback, Database and Playlists

Tagnavi format line does not allow for the <condition> to include a <connective>

(1/1)

anonamoth:
Hi folks, I apologize if this issue has already been addressed, I searched the forum but was unable to find it.

In the wiki, the format line is described as: %format <fmt_identifier> <formatting> [<modifier>]* [? <condition>]

with the <condition> elements being: <clause> [<connective> <clause>]

However, it seems that the <connective> can only be used in the menu and does not apply to the format line.

For most tracks, the title is displayed as: 1-05. Track Title - 3:45
But I would like to include the artist <tag> for tracks within a compilation album: 1-05. Track Title - Artist Name

"%d-%2d. %s %s" discnum tracknum title artist ? discnum > "0" & albumartist = "[Compilations]"
- In my library, the albumartist tag is written as "[Compilations]" for all tracks within a compilation album
- Lm and Ls can't be included b/c only 5 tags can be displayed, correct?

Unfortunately, when using the above format line in the tagnavi, only the first <clause> is used. So ANY track with a discnumber will display the artist tag in the track title.

Am I missing something here?

Thanks.

anonamoth:
Appears to be a bug:

https://www.rockbox.org/tracker/task/12853?project=1&order=category&sort=asc&pagenum=9

Navigation

[0] Message Index

Go to full version